
Gallix is an open-source software offered by Eternilab.
We provide security monitoring and specialized services to configure, secure, control, and maintain secure servers based on Linux Debian.
Gallix for server prepares a secure server compliant with ANSSI frameworks such as GHI, PAMS, and SecNumCloud. It also implements the recommendations of the CIS Benchmark. The premium version complies with II901 in order to achieve the Restricted Information level.
This server is a key component of defense strategies, addressing the following points:
- Isolation: Create a machine dedicated to sensitive activities.
- Strong authentication: Deploy your authentication solutions.
- Encryption: Encrypt configurations, passwords, and access keys. Encrypt communications.
- Restricted access: Control access to machines and infrastructures using controlled protocols.
- Session management: Restrict the use of privileged sessions. Control machine capabilities.
- Protection: Fight against malware. Ensure server integrity.
- Monitoring: Trace and analyze actions performed by administrators.
- Updates and patches: Ensure regular updates of the operating system and software.
Gallix for server enables the deployment of hardening tools and produces a compliance report that can be used as evidence during a qualifying audit.
It is delivered as installation scripts, accompanied by audit tools for hardening features and report generation tools.
In its premium version, certain features are selected from the catalog of ANSSI-certified and qualified solutions and require additional licenses.

Example Report
After each installation, a report is generated to verify that the hardening tools have been properly deployed and that the workstation complies with the selected framework.
A list of non-compliances is highlighted to help teams correct them quickly.

Hardened Linux
Gallix for server is an implementation compliant with French security frameworks and corresponds to the Hardened Linux concept.
